President Trump brought Republican Sen. Rand Paul to Trump National Golf Club in Virginia on Sunday to play golf with him, a little more than a week after the party's healthcare bill failed.
"They're discussing a variety of topics, including healthcare," White House deputy press secretary Stephanie Grisham said.
Budget director Mick Mulvaney, a former leading House conservative, also joined the two.
